News

On Monday, Beach reported a net loss of A$43.8 million for the 12 months through June, compared to a A$475.3 million loss a year earlier. Stripping out the impact of the impairment charges, Beach's ...
Dow Jones Newswires is a market-moving financial and business news source, used by wealth managers, institutional investors and fintech platforms around the world to identify trading and investing ...